Es ist bekannt, Röntgenaufnahmen eines auf einem Patienten bett liegenden Patienten in der Weise anzufertigen, daß unter den Patienten eine Röntgenfilmkassette geschoben wird und daß ein mobiles Röntgenaufnahmegerät mit einem dreidimensional einstellbaren Röntgenstrahler an das Patientenbett herange fahren wird. Der Röntgenstrahler wird dabei so eingestellt, daß seine Strahlung den Röntgenfilm exakt trifft. Die Rönt genfilmkassette wird nach der Anfertigung einer Aufnahme un ter dem Patienten herausgezogen und der Röntgenfilm ent wickelt.It is known to take one x-ray on a patient to make bedding patients in such a way that under the patient is pushed an X-ray film cassette and that a mobile x-ray machine with a three-dimensional adjustable X-ray tube to the patient bed will drive. The X-ray source is set so that its radiation hits the X-ray film exactly. The X-ray Genfilmkassette will un after the recording pulled out of the patient and the X-ray film removed wraps.
Das geschilderte Verfahren ist für manche Patienten bela stend, denn für das Einschieben und Entfernen der Röntgen filmkassette muß der Patient angehoben werden.The described procedure is bela for some patients stend, because for the insertion and removal of the x-ray the patient must be lifted.
Es ist auch bereits bekannt, Röntgenaufnahmen am liegenden Patienten dadurch anzufertigen, daß im Patiententisch ein Fach vorgesehen wird, in das ein Bildempfänger einschiebbar ist (WO 96/03077). Auf dem Patiententisch muß natürlich noch eine Auflage für den Patienten aufgelegt werden, so daß sich dadurch ein relativ großer Abstand zwischen dem Bildempfänger und dem Patienten ergibt.It is also known to lie on x-rays To manufacture patients in that in the patient table Compartment is provided in which an image receiver can be inserted is (WO 96/03077). Of course, there still has to be on the patient table a support for the patient be placed so that thereby a relatively large distance between the image receiver and gives to the patient.
Der Erfindung liegt die Aufgabe zugrunde, ein Patientenbett zu schaffen, bei dem die Anfertigung von Röntgenaufnahmen gegenüber dem Stand der Technik in der Weise vereinfacht ist, daß einerseits der Patient hierzu nicht bewegt, insbesondere angehoben werden muß, und andererseits sich ein minimaler Abstand zwischen dem Patienten und dem Bildempfänger ergibt. The invention has for its object a patient bed to create where the taking of x-rays is simplified compared to the prior art in such a way that on the one hand the patient does not move, especially raised must be, and on the other hand there is a minimal distance between the Patient and the image receiver results.
Diese Aufgabe ist erfindungsgemäß gelöst durch die Merkmale des Patentanspruches 1. Bei der Erfindung ist ein Flachdetek tor, insbesondere auf der Basis von a-Si, der von einer Matrix von Detektorelementen gebildet ist, direkt in der als Matratze oder damit vergleichbare Polsterauflage ausgebilde ten Patientenauflage fest eingebaut. Seine Bildsignale werden von einer Elektronik, die am Patientenbett angebaut sein kann, verarbeitet, so daß das erzeugte Röntgenbild auf einem Monitor wiedergegeben werden kann.According to the invention, this object is achieved by the features of claim 1. In the invention is a flat detector gate, in particular based on a-Si, that of a Matrix is formed by detector elements, directly in the as Form mattress or comparable cushion cover fixed patient support. His image signals are from electronics that are attached to the patient bed can, processed so that the generated X-ray image on a Monitor can be played.
Die Erfindung ist nachfolgend anhand eines in der Zeichnung dargestellten Ausführungsbeispiels näher erläutert.The invention is based on one in the drawing illustrated embodiment explained in more detail.
In der Zeichnung ist ein Patientenbett 1 dargestellt, das einen Rahmen 2 und eine Matratze 3 als Auflage aufweist, in der ein Flachde tektor 4 fest eingebaut ist. Der Flachdetektor 4 ist von einer Matrix von Detektorelementen, vorzugsweise auf der Basis von a-Si gebildet. Von ihm führt eine Leitung 5 in der Matratze 3 zu einer Elektronik 6, in der die Signale des Detektors 4 zu einem Röntgenbild verarbeitet werden. Die Wiedergabe des Röntgenbildes kann an einem Monitor 7 erfolgen, der über eine Steckverbindung 8 am Patientenbett 1 angeschlossen werden kann. Es können die Bilder auch an Bilddatennetze übertragen werden. Eine weitere Steckverbindung 9 stellt einen Netzanschluß dar.In the drawing, a patient bed 1 is shown, which has a frame 2 and a mattress 3 as a support in which a flat detector 4 is permanently installed. The flat detector 4 is formed by a matrix of detector elements, preferably based on a-Si. From it, a line 5 leads in the mattress 3 to electronics 6 , in which the signals of the detector 4 are processed into an X-ray image. The x-ray image can be reproduced on a monitor 7 , which can be connected to the patient bed 1 via a connector 8 . The images can also be transmitted to image data networks. Another connector 9 represents a network connection.
Für die Anfertigung von Röntgenaufnahmen ist ein fahrbares Aufnahmegerät 10 vorgesehen, das einen Röntgengenerator 11 und einen Röntgenstrahler 12 an einem Stativ 13 trägt. Das Stativ 13 ist gelenkig ausgebildet, so daß der Röntgenstrah ler 12 dreidimensional im Raum einstellbar ist. Das Röntgen aufnahmegerät 10 wird zur Anfertigung einer Röntgenaufnahme ans Patientenbett 1 herangefahren und der Röntgenstrahler 12 wird so eingestellt, daß der Flachdetektor 4 exakt von der Röntgenstrahlung getroffen wird.A mobile recording device 10 is provided for the production of X-ray recordings, which carries an X-ray generator 11 and an X-ray emitter 12 on a stand 13 . The tripod 13 is articulated so that the X-ray beam 12 is three-dimensionally adjustable in space. The X-ray apparatus 10 of an X-ray exposure to the patient's bed 1 is moved and custom tailoring of the X-ray source 12 is adjusted so that the flat panel detector 4 is made accurately by the X-ray radiation.
In allen Fällen ist es nicht er forderlich, den Patienten für die Anfertigung einer Röntgen aufnahme zu bewegen, insbesondere anzuheben.In all cases it is not him required the patient for an x-ray to move the recording, especially to raise it.
